首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

实现-光速虚拟机技术内幕

实现-光速虚拟机技术内幕 背景 光速虚拟机是基于系统和ARM处理器架构实现的一套虚拟化技术,在系统的用户态空间无需特殊权限实现了一套完整的内核和硬件抽象层,能够在APP内部运行另外一个系统...光速虚拟机是通过来实现。光速虚拟机是市面上第一家在手机上实现完整虚拟化的产品。...光速虚拟机内部可以运行4.4-10系统和未来更高版本的系统,目前外发的版本支持7.1.2。这样能保证一些老的应用和游戏能够在新的系统上运行起来。...对上层提供标准的内核接口。这样虚拟机内部运行的系统将不依赖于手机内核的实现,可以实现在5-11上运行任意版本的系统,这意味着可以在5的手机上运行7,或者11。...兼容性和性能评估 安全虚拟手机在内核基础上完整模拟了一个新的内核和硬件抽象层,性能、兼容性接近真机。 应用兼容性: 一个完整的运行环境,技术原理上可以做到跟用户手机的兼容一致。

9.2K4926
您找到你想要的搜索结果了吗?
是的
没有找到

面试必问的虚拟机,你真的掌握了么?——虚拟机基础知识回顾

type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AQjF1ZVNvY2tz,size_20,color_FFFFFF,t_70,g_se,x_16] 前言 21世纪,虚拟机正在一步步的走入我们的生活...,小到个人部分朋友在电脑上使用虚拟机玩手游,大到从业人员在虚拟机上面跑程序。...不得不承认,对于每一位Androider 而言,虚拟机是我们日常开发中不可或缺的一环,但是关于虚拟机的一些知识点和小细节你真的完全掌握了么?...HeapReference component_type_; // 这个类对应的 DexCache 对象,虚拟机直接创建的类没有这个值(数组、基本类型) HeapReference...self->AssertPendingException(); return sdc.Finish(nullptr); } klass->SetDexCache(dex_cache); 结尾 好了,今天有关虚拟机的内容就到此为止了

55040

macaca 环境搭建篇,(web 和

appium研究一段时间,感觉appium太不稳定了, 后来听说了阿里开源了macaca,那么我就想尝尝鲜,啥都不说,我感觉还是赶紧上手搭建环境吧。...下面设置环境变量: 【我的电脑】->右键菜单--->属性--->高级--->环境变量--->系统变量-->新建: 变量名:JAVA_HOME 变量值:D:\Program Files (x86)\Java...下面设置环境变量: 【我的电脑】右键菜单--->属性--->高级--->环境变量--->系统变量-->新建.....由于是用node.js开发,所以少不了node.js 那么我们就来下载node.js,记得要放到环境变量中去。...python,所以我会以python为例来记录我学习过程的坑,下面环境配置好就可以写脚本测试了, 检查下, ?

1.2K10

2018年的开发环境搭建

首先设置ANDROID_SDK_ROOT环境变量,值设置为SDK文件夹存放位置。 然后设置ANDROID_AVD_HOME环境变量,值设置为模拟器的存放位置。...记得修改一下SDK安装位置,这里好像不认前面设置的环境变量。 这里提示一下,如果你重装过系统,而且原来的SDK还在的话,可能会在这里出现安装错误。...如果你是英特尔CPU,而且前面安装了自带的预配置好的优化版x86模拟器,现在可以直接点击Tool -> AVD Manager,打开虚拟机管理器,然后直接点击绿色运行按钮来启动。...很遗憾我用的AMD锐龙处理器,所以无法运行x86模拟器,准确的说是无法在关闭HyperV的情况下运行,因为我同时还要运行其他虚拟机软件。所以只能使用另一种办法,那就是直接在手机上运行。...这样一来,一个崭新的开发环境就搭建完毕了。之后就可以好好开始学习如何开发程序了。

1.6K20

VMOS Pro(虚拟机) 去授权版

应用简介 VMOS(虚拟大师)是一款以Virtual Machine(简称VM,即虚拟机)技术为主的APP(应用)软件。...无需root权限,以普通应用安装的形式运行到任意版本的linux或系统上。可定制操作系统版本、功能。定制的操作系统拥有root权限,权限不会涉及宿主系统的安全问题。...具体应用可真机和虚拟机双开应用和游戏,支持同屏操作,悬浮窗切换,后台运行。...虚拟机自带root,支持XP框架和谷歌套件,不必担心真机风险,可自定义分辨率,自带root权限,支持XP框架和谷歌套件,满足极客手机爱好者的各种需求。...VMOS里的文件中转站支持真机虚拟机应用文件相互克隆,免去繁琐的重复安装。

3.6K30

Appium和iOS开发环境安装

Desktop 2  通过Node.js安装 官网的下载地址为:https://github.com/appium/appium-desktop/releases/tag/v1.11.0 win10环境安装...Android开发环境配置 使用设备做App抓取的话,还需要下载和配置Android SDK,推荐安装Android Studio 下载地址为: https://developer.android.com...下载完成后,还需要配置一下环境变量,添加ANDROID_HOME 为Android SDK所在路径,在添加SDK文件下的tools和platform-tools文件夹到PATH中 iOS开发环境 Appium...以上版本 Xcode 8 以上版本 配置满足要求后,执行如下命令即可配置开发依赖的一些库和工具: xcode-select -- install  如果想要用真机运行测试和数据抓取,还需要额外配置其它环境...,参考环境:https://github.com/appium/appium/blob/master/docs/en/drivers/ios-xcuitest-real-devices.md

3.5K30
领券